Cov txheej txheem:

Lub Sij Hawm Mus Los: 5 Kauj Ruam
Lub Sij Hawm Mus Los: 5 Kauj Ruam

Video: Lub Sij Hawm Mus Los: 5 Kauj Ruam

Video: Lub Sij Hawm Mus Los: 5 Kauj Ruam
Video: Sib Hawm Dhau (Time Passed) Music Video by: Deeda/Dib Xwb 2024, Lub Xya hli ntuj
Anonim
Image
Image

Lub Sijhawm Mus Los Los yog lub moos uas tshaj tawm lub sijhawm thaum nias, hais lus hauv kuv tus tub uas muaj ob xyoos uas kuv kaw tseg hais tias teev, "lub hlis twg rau", "ib nrab dhau los" thiab lwm yam.

Tsis tas yuav hais, ua hluas li nws nyuam qhuav tau txais tus lej raug thiab ua qhov yuam kev yuam kev ntawm txoj kev - yuam kev uas tam sim no, ob xyoos tom qab (thiab tej zaum tom qab), zoo siab rau peb pob ntseg, ntxiv rau pog thiab yawg, txiv ntxawm thiab tsev neeg seem.

Kev ua ntawm lub moos yog qhov yooj yim heev. Xyoo dhau los kuv xav tias kuv tau pom ob peb txoj hauv kev thiab cov tswv yim txhawm rau ua kom txoj haujlwm yooj yim yooj yim, thiab ua cov qauv ua haujlwm rau ntau xyoo thiab ntau xyoo, yam tsis tas yuav tsim PCB tshwj xeeb lossis cov laug cam. Kuv vam tias koj yuav pom nws yooj yim los tsim, ib yam.

Lub moos tau qhib los ntawm ib lub 18650 Li/Ion roj teeb tau nce mus txog 5V, thiab nws tau khaws cia nyob rau hauv hom pw tsaug zog feem ntau ntawm lub sijhawm, yog li nws yuav tsum tsis txhob siv lub zog ntau tshwj tsis yog ua haujlwm txuas ntxiv (qee yam uas tuaj yeem tshwm sim hauv thawj ob peb hnub, tshwj xeeb tshaj yog thaum muaj menyuam yaus). Txawm li cas los xij, lub roj teeb tuaj yeem them rov qab thiab los nrog kev them nyiaj thiab tshem tawm kev tiv thaiv kev tiv thaiv, yog li nws yuav tsum yooj yim kom rov ua dua thiab tsis tsim cov pov tseg ntxiv hauv ntiaj teb ntiaj teb.

Dab tsi ntxiv? Yog lawm Nov yog kuv rov qab mus rau qhov tshwm sim ntawm kev sau 'ibles tom qab qee lub sijhawm kuv tsis tau ua li ntawd. Yog li, kuv yuav xeb me ntsis ntawm qhov ntawd, thov zam txim rau kuv ua ntej. Kuv yuav sim ua kom luv thiab qab zib.

Peb puas yuav pib, yog li?

Kauj Ruam 1: Cov Cuab Yeej thiab Cov Khoom Siv

Cov cuab yeej thiab cov khoom siv
Cov cuab yeej thiab cov khoom siv
Cov cuab yeej thiab cov khoom siv
Cov cuab yeej thiab cov khoom siv

Cov Cuab Yeej:

Cutter

Soldering Hlau nrog qee cov laug

Qhov pom lossis rab riam ntse (rau ua lub qhov khawm)

Cov khoom xyaw:

Arduino Nano Cov

Cov tswj hwm micro-ubiquitous peb txhua tus paub thiab nyiam

Arduino Sensor ShieldA cov cuab yeej siv tau rau kev sib txuas ceev thiab txhim khu kev qha

Mosfet ModuleUse kom ua rau lub mp3 module qhib thiab tawm, kom txuag hluav taws xob

Serial MP3 Player (hloov tshiab, liab) Super yooj yim module rau ua MP3 cov ntaub ntawv

2GB Micro SD Card Siv los khaws cov ntaub ntawv MP3

18650 Li/Ion roj teeb yog tias koj muaj lub laptop tuag, cov roj teeb no feem ntau yog qhov ua tau zoo. Lawv ntim ntau lub zog thiab rau qhov nruab nrab microcontroller project, txawm tias ib nrab roj teeb tuag tuaj yeem siv sijhawm ntev heev.

18650 Li/Ion roj teeb tuav/them nyiaj Kuv nyiam cov no ib qho kev daws teeb meem-rau-txhua yam khoom, txawm hais tias qhov no yog thawj zaug kuv siv nws hauv ib qhov project

RTC DS3231 ModuleCov no zoo dua li cov qauv DS1307 yav dhau los, txij li lawv tau them nyiaj rau lub sijhawm tsis raug los ntawm kev hloov pauv kub.

Big Arcade ButtonBig effing khawm, yuav hais dab tsi. Kev txaus siab thiab kev zoo siab ntawm txhua qhov project.

Dupont Wires lossis Servo WiresFor ua ntau yam kev sib txuas ntawm cov khoom siv

BoxI siv IKEA lub thawv ntim khoom uas tau muag ntawm lwm hnub.

Muab Ob Sab Ob Kab Xev Los tso txhua yam ua ke, tau kawg. Daim kab xev ob tog yog cov khoom uas lub neej tau ua los ntawm.

Kauj ruam 2: Sib dhos

Los ua ke
Los ua ke
Los ua ke
Los ua ke
Los ua ke
Los ua ke

Txuas Mosfet lub teeb liab nkag mus rau Arduino siv lub xov tooj cua servo lossis poj niam-poj niam dupont xov hlau. Nco ntsoov tias GND thiab VCC txuas nrog Arduino cov neeg sib koom thiab tias Mosfet lub teeb liab tus pin txuas nrog tus pin 4 ntawm Arduino.

Tom ntej no, Hlau Arduino's VCC thiab GND mus rau Mosfet's Vin thiab GND davhlau ya nyob twg, siv Dupont xov hlau. Txij li cov khoom sib txuas ntawm Mosfet yog lub dav hlau ntsia hlau, nws yog qhov zoo tshaj kom tshem cov yas npog ntawm dupont qhov twg yuav tsum tau txuas nrog Mosfet, kom nws haum. Qhov no tuaj yeem ua tiav los ntawm kev nqa lub hnab yas thiab maj mam rub cov xaim.

Tom ntej no, txuas MP3 Player's VCC thiab GND lub dav hlau mus rau V+ thiab V- ntawm Mosfet module, thiab MP3 RX thiab TX pins rau Arduino pins 5 thiab 6, feem. Txuas tus neeg hais lus txuas rau tus neeg ua si, thiab qhov ntawd yuav xaus qhov kev sib txuas ntxiv uas tau ua nrog lub MP3 player.

Tam sim no txuas 2 lub xov hlau mus rau lub roj teeb hauv lub thawv 5V thiab GND thiab txuas lawv mus rau Arduino qhov sib xws VCC thiab GND pins. Qhov ntawd yog peb lub hwj chim. Koj tuaj yeem siv cov kab hluav taws xob servo lossis Dupont xov hlau.

Tom ntej no, txuas Dupont / servo xov hlau rau lub pob thiab txuas rau GND thiab tus pin 2. Thaum siv cov xov hlau servo, xyuas kom tseeb tias koj siv cov rooj sib tham xim qhov twg liab zoo, dub tsis zoo thiab dawb yog teeb liab. Nyob rau hauv rooj plaub ntawm lub pob, koj yuav tsum tau txuas tsuas yog GND thiab Teeb liab pins rau lub pob, raws li tus pin yuav rub tawm.

Kawg tab sis yeej tsis tsawg - lub moos nws tus kheej. Txuas RTC tus qauv siv 4 Dupont xov hlau mus rau I2C Chaw nres nkoj muaj nyob ntawm daim ntaub thaiv npog (hais rau koj, nws yog lub cuab yeej me me zoo, qhov no). xyuas kom tseeb tias GND, VCC, SDA, SCL pins tau sib phim ntawm ob sab.

Kauj ruam 3: Kho kom raug suab

Kho kom raug suab
Kho kom raug suab
Kho kom raug suab
Kho kom raug suab

Nruab Audacity, yog tias koj tsis muaj nws tau teeb tsa lawm.

Sau koj tus tub / ntxhais yau tshaj txhua tus lej ntawm 1-12. Tom qab ntawd, kom lawv hais "nws yog tam sim no", "peb lub hlis dhau los", "ib nrab dhau los", "peb lub hlis twg rau" thiab "moos". Koj tuaj yeem siv koj lub computer lossis xov tooj (tom qab xa nws mus rau koj lub khoos phis tawj txhawm rau kho).

Tua tawm Audacity thiab ntshuam kaw suab. Raws li cov ntaub ntawv kaw tseg, koj yuav xav tau teeb tsa kev txiav txim siab plugin, raws li tau piav qhia ntawm no.

Tam sim no, ib qho los ntawm ib qho cim cov ntu uas cuam tshuam nrog cov lus "1", "2", "3", thiab lwm yam. Xaiv Suab thiab khaws cov ntawv ua MP3. Txog theem no, koj yuav tsum teeb tsa LAME encoder, thov saib cov lus qhia ntawm no.

Thaum kawg ntawm tus txheej txheem, koj yuav tsum muaj cov ntaub ntawv npe 001xxx.mp3, 002xxx.mp3,… txog 012xxx.mp3, txhua tus muaj cov ntaub ntawv kaw tseg ntawm nws tus lej. xws li cov ntaub ntawv 007xxx.mp3 yuav hais "Xya" thaum ua si. Tom ntej no, sau lub kaw suab ntxiv raws li daim ntawv teev npe:

020xxx.mp3 = "nws yog tam sim no"

021xxx.mp3 = "peb lub hlis dhau los"

022xxx.mp3 = "ib nrab dhau los"

023xxx.mp3 = "peb lub hlis twg rau"

024xxx.mp3 = "moos"

Tsim daim nplaub tshev ntawm SD hauv paus npe "01" thiab luam tag nrho cov ntaub ntawv saum toj no rau nws.

Tam sim no lo daim npav SD sab hauv MP3 player.

Nco tseg: Tam sim no, lub sijhawm tshaj tawm cov qauv tshaj tawm yog rau Askiv thiab Hebrew nkaus xwb, tab sis nrog kev hloov pauv me me koj tuaj yeem hloov tus lej rau koj tus kheej cov lus, yog tias txawv ntawm ob qho no. Lub sijhawm no, xyuas kom tseeb tias koj sau txhua qhov

Kauj ruam 4: Code

Rub tawm qhov project code thiab rho tawm zip.

Tua tawm Arduino IDE (Kuv tau siv version 1.8.5) thiab nyob rau hauv kev nyiam, hloov qhov sketchbook qhov chaw mus rau lub hauv paus ntawm cov rho tawm zip. Kaw thiab rov pib dua Arduino IDE thiab lub sijhawm no, hauv Cov Ntaub Ntawv -> Sketchbook, koj yuav tsum pom BoboClockV13 -qhib nws.

Txhawm rau Arduino teeb tsa lub sijhawm ntawm RTC, tsis suav nrog kab:

// #define ADJUST_DATE_TIME_NOW

Txuas koj Arduino nano mus rau lub khoos phis tawj thiab xa cov duab kos mus rau lub rooj tsavxwm.

Qhib tus lej saib thiab xyuas kom tseeb tias koj pom lub sijhawm raug tso tawm ntawm lub vijtsam thaum lub pob nyem, thiab lub sijhawm tau tshaj tawm, hauv lub suab ntawm koj tus me. Zoo kawg! (tsis yog?)

tam sim no, nws yog qhov tseem ceeb tshaj tawm cov kab koj nyuam qhuav tsis tau pom dua thiab xa cov cai ntxiv (txwv tsis pub, ntawm txhua Arduino rov pib dua, lub moos yuav rov pib dua nws tus kheej rau lub sijhawm kawg upload)

Txhua yam ua haujlwm? Auj, zoo. Cia peb ntim nws, ces.

Kauj Ruam 5: Ntim

Image
Image
Ntim
Ntim
Ntim
Ntim

Yog li … pob tau tawm mus tiag tiag rau tus tsim khoom, txhua tus tej zaum yuav xav tau lawv tus kheej lub thawv tshwj xeeb nws/nws tau txais los ntawm qhov chaw. Yog li, ntawm no kuv yuav txwv cov lus qhia rau yam uas koj yuav tsum ua nyob rau hauv rooj plaub ntau dua li tham sib cais ntawm txhua lub thawv. Kuv siv IKEA cov thawv, feem ntau yog rau lawv tus nqi, tab sis lawv ua haujlwm ib yam nkaus.

Pib los ntawm kev tuav tuav rau koj lub pob rau sab saum toj ntawm lub thawv. Pom lub qhov pom zoo hauv theem no, txawm hais tias X-Acto riam yuav zaum ua haujlwm tau zoo ib yam nkaus, yog tias koj tsis hlais koj cov ntiv tes, tsis nco qab thiab ua rau koj tus kheej tuag rau hauv chav ua noj. Zoo dua nyab xeeb ces tsis muaj ntiv tes, yog?

Tom qab ntawd, siv daim kab xev ob tog txhawm rau txhawm rau txhua yam kom zoo hauv lub thawv. Nyob ntawm koj lub npov thiab lub suab, yuav tsum muaj lub qhov me me ntxiv rau tus hais lus, txhawm rau ua kom pom lub suab nrov.

Vam tias, qhov kev tsim no yuav tsum tsis txhob siv ntau tshaj li qhov tsis khoom nyob rau lub asthiv, thiab thaum kawg koj nyob nrog cov khoom uas yuav ua rau koj lom zem ntau xyoo thiab ntau xyoo …

Ua tsaug rau koj nyeem Cov Lus Qhia no! Yog tias koj nyiam nws, thov txiav txim siab pov npav rau kuv ntawm Kev Sib Tw Suab

Kev thaj yeeb,

Pom zoo: